In ‘Another Man's War’, veteran foreign correspondent Barnaby Phillips delivers the gripping, unforgettable story of a Burma Boy in the Second World War and the legacy of the British Empire in Africa and Asia.
Join Barnaby Phillips as he discusses this story of friendship and courage which transcends race and culture, and explores how Britain forgot its debt to African soldiers.
Event will consist of short film made by the author and then conversation between Barnaby and Richard Dowden, Director of the Royal African Society
